WebSodium oxide is a base because it can neutralise an acid. Sodium oxide can be dissolved in water to produce sodium hydroxide. The pH of this solution would be 14, which shows it is an alkali. Web15 de ago. de 2024 · Sodium oxide is a simple strongly basic oxide.
